From: Phil Pennock Date: Wed, 23 Mar 2011 02:28:33 +0000 (-0400) Subject: Avoid segfault on ref:name specified as uid. X-Git-Tag: exim-4_76_RC1~10 X-Git-Url: https://git.exim.org/exim.git/commitdiff_plain/084c1d8c14da86888bbffc31a54246dc6e2e8147 Avoid segfault on ref:name specified as uid. If group not also specified, make this a fatal error. If group specified, we'll error out anyway unless the group can be resolved. Approach considered but not followed: fatal config error if built with ref:name where name is a number. fixes bug 1098 --- diff --git a/doc/doc-txt/ChangeLog b/doc/doc-txt/ChangeLog index 7105e5fc6..2b3ec8573 100644 --- a/doc/doc-txt/ChangeLog +++ b/doc/doc-txt/ChangeLog @@ -15,6 +15,9 @@ PP/03 New openssl_options items: no_sslv2 no_sslv3 no_ticket no_tlsv1 PP/04 New "dns_use_edns0" global option. +PP/05 Don't segfault on misconfiguration of ref:name exim-user as uid. + Bugzilla 1098. + Exim version 4.75 ----------------- diff --git a/src/src/exim.c b/src/src/exim.c index 30974c9c6..528ffc7c8 100644 --- a/src/src/exim.c +++ b/src/src/exim.c @@ -1414,7 +1414,19 @@ if (route_finduser(US EXIM_USERNAME, &pw, &exim_uid)) EXIM_USERNAME); exit(EXIT_FAILURE); } - exim_gid = pw->pw_gid; + /* If ref:name uses a number as the name, route_finduser() returns + TRUE with exim_uid set and pw coerced to NULL. */ + if (pw) + exim_gid = pw->pw_gid; +#ifndef EXIM_GROUPNAME + else + { + fprintf(stderr, + "exim: ref:name should specify a usercode, not a group.\n" + "exim: can't let you get away with it unless you also specify a group.\n"); + exit(EXIT_FAILURE); + } +#endif } else {
